Early Life and Education
Sean Bonet's early life was influenced by his father's career as an oncologist, which led the family from London to Australia seeking better opportunities. He experienced challenges adapting to school, initially struggling due to being placed in a grade that did not match his capabilities, resulting in a reassessment that put him in the right year. By age 14, he had completed high school and transitioned to university, where he pursued a double degree in Law and Arts with a focus on Economics and Psychology. This education laid the foundation for his future entrepreneurial ventures, although he initially worked as a corporate lawyer.
